Transaction 12181c2d39763ab02934b5a6593338723cdef61d6fbb01fb454cbf6facf81095
1 Input
2 Outputs
- 12181c2d39763ab02934b5a6593338723cdef61d6fbb01fb454cbf6facf81095:0
- 12181c2d39763ab02934b5a6593338723cdef61d6fbb01fb454cbf6facf81095:1
value 658163
address 1CA7aotULHJ1ehSJcLPyqmcRX9sjWCGexT
value 587958884
address 15oDcknvTWi71o9jtxtR6cA2VGiLnKkMB5